A compelling exploration of personal development, relationships, and self-reliance emerges from a series of discussions centered on navigating romantic dynamics, personal growth, and the psychological underpinnings of relationships. With a focus on themes such as loyalty, trust, and communication, the dialogue often reflects on real-life scenarios shared by listeners. Topics range from the complexities surrounding infidelity and the cultural dynamics of attraction to practical strategies for rekindling relationships. This podcast stands out for its candid, no-nonsense approach to advising men on understanding women's perspectives and effectively managing their own emotional needs and boundaries in dating contexts.
